2. What are the basic concepts of Operations Management and
TQM?

Operations Management (OM) and Total Quality Management (TQM)


both focus on optimizing production processes while ensuring high
quality. Operations Management (OM) involves process design,
capacity planning, supply chain management, inventory
management, quality management, lean operations, scheduling, and
forecasting to enhance efficiency and meet customer demands.
While on the other hand, Total Quality Management (TQM)
emphasizes customer focus, continuous improvement, employee
involvement, process-centered approaches, integrated systems, fact-
based decision-making, strategic alignment, and effective
communication to maintain consistent quality across the
organization. Together, these approaches aim to enhance efficiency,
quality, and customer satisfaction.
